Long time NFL star and Ivy League-educated Seth Payne welcomes you to Deceptively Fast. While the podcast promises break downs and unique takes on all of the biggest sports stories, it also features a weekly episode with an expert. The experts range from authors and dieticians to comedians and scientists, offering you a taste of everything that piques Seth’s interest - including health and physical/mental fitness. On the football side, you’ll hear from current and former players, Seth’s former teammates, and analysts from across the country. You’ll get fresh takes and perspective on everything happening around the NFL. Seth played defensive tackle in the NFL for ten years. He spent time with the Jacksonville Jaguars and the Houston Texans. Before his NFL career, he attended Cornell University. You can find Seth on Twitter and Instagram @SethCPayne.
